  • Volume of a prism(any solid with parallel sides)
    Volume = cross-sectional area x height
    V = CSA x H
    (ANY SOLID WITH PARALLEL SIDES THAT HAS A CONSTANT CROSS-SECTION IS CALLED A PRISM)
  • Volume of a cone
    13×πr2×h\frac{1}{3}\times\pi r^2\times h
  • Curved surface area of a cone
    Curved surface area = πrl\pi rl
    (L = the slant height)
  • Volume of a cuboid
    Volume of cuboid = width x depth x height
  • Surface area of a cuboid (a prism with a rectangular cross section)
    Surface area = sum of the area of the si rectangles making up the face
  • Volume of a cylinder
    Volume of a cylinder = πr2h\pi r^2h
  • Curved surface area of a cylinder
    2πrh2\pi rh
  • Volume of a sphere
    Volume of a sphere = 43πr3\frac{4}{3}\pi r^3
  • Surface area of a sphere
    4πr24\pi r^2
